Factory verification and citable facts

The stability of Alcohol Resistant Hot Stamping Foil for Cosmetic Packaging and Plastic Caps cannot be judged by color cards alone. Before mass production, substrate material, surface energy, ink or UV varnish condition, die engraving depth, press type, and downstream packaging requirements should be checked in one sampling record. PINTE usually confirms the application first, then uses A4 sheets or small sample rolls to evaluate transfer completeness, edge definition, adhesion, rub resistance, and color consistency.

  • Structure check: PET carrier, release layer, color or metallic layer, and adhesive layer jointly determine the transfer window.
  • Process check: flat stamping, rotary stamping, cold foil, digital enhancement, and large solid areas require different pressure and speed windows.
  • Acceptance check: record temperature, pressure, speed, roll width, core, winding direction, batch number, and target substrate together.

Q: Why does cosmetic packaging need alcohol-resistant foil?
A: Perfume, skincare, cleaning and filling processes may contact alcohol. Alcohol-resistant foil helps reduce rubbing, peeling and logo loss after exposure.
Q: Can this foil be used on PP or PE?
A: It can be sampled, but PP and PE are low surface energy plastics and may need surface treatment or grade adjustment.
Q: What tests should cosmetic packaging run?
A: Run cross-cut tape, alcohol rubbing, scratch, rub and transfer-completeness tests on the actual plastic part.
